Are Vince Young, Marc Bulger and John Beck -- that much *better* than McNabb? Come on, McNabb (in his second year in system) should be comparable to these guys. Sure he didn't do well last year, and now we've benched him an alienated him. Perhaps he wasn't right for Shanahan's system. McNabb made poor decisions and didn't know the playbook as well as he should.

BUT:
1) McNabb was hired only 4-5 months before season
2) It was the first year in new offensive system for everyone on offense
3) Poor offensive line play
4) 3rd and 4th string RBs with Portis and even Torrain out for part/most of system
5) Only an aging Moss and a CFL wide receiver to throw to..


I just think McNabb had an off year, but people are throwing him under the bus. He was a Pro Bowl QB for 10 years, and I don't think you lose it in 1-2 years. Is he what he was when he went to the Super Bowl? Maybe not, but I don't think he's "washed up" quite yet.

I know he's on his way out, but I would have preferred to keep McNabb, tailor the offense around him and use him for 2-3 years like we planned. Now we're just searching for another FA QB, without any assurance they'll be better or viable long-term. McNabb is now just a wasted 2nd round (& mid-round) draft pick. Not to mention - we could have kept Campbell, and he couldn't have done too much worse.
